Job Description

Responsibilities

  • manage and develop a small team to deliver increasing email engagement.
  • understand our customers and where they are in their Warhammer journey.
  • From acquiring new subscribers, through to building engagement and strengthening loyalty from our existing fans, you will identify opportunities to create great customer relationships and deepen engagement for the long-term.
  • help define the long-term approach to email , identifying opportunities to improve customer experience through personalisation, segmentation and regionalisation.
  • continually look for ways to improve our way of working, ensuring we stay up to date with new technologies and best practices, and continue to engage our fans by delivering the right message to the right person at the right time.

Requirements

  • demonstrable experience in Email Marketing and experience using marketing, sales and customer retention systems for delivering targeted, effective campaigns.
  • able to ensure all content is personalised and data driven across all customer touchpoints.
  • comfortable working to shifting deadlines, can drive a team to deliver exceptional results and foster an environment that values open communication and collaboration.

Benefits

  • 33 days holiday per year (including public holidays), matching contributory pension scheme up to 7.5%, profit share bonus (subject to GW meeting profit targets) and option to join our Share Save scheme. Oh and let’s not forget, a staff discount of between 25% and 50% on our products!
